- In the Cloud Networking team, we work with networking technologies to innovate
- planet-scale networking with secure, reliable and efficient services, to enable
- customers and partners to achieve new opportunities with cloud services. We are
- building networking and network security solutions for Google Cloud customers to
- help them simplify and accelerate their journey to the cloud by meeting them
- where they are (e.g., migrating workloads, building a modern cloud native
- application stack, consuming and gathering insights from data, running AI/ML
- workloads, designing security for applications, data, and users).
